The Role of 2,4-Dichlorofluorobenzene in Pharmaceutical Synthesis
In the intricate world of pharmaceutical synthesis, the quality and reliability of starting materials and intermediates are paramount. One such critical compound is 2,4-Dichlorofluorobenzene (CAS 1435-48-9), a halogenated aromatic compound that plays a pivotal role in the development and production of advanced medicines, particularly fluoroquinolone antibiotics.
Understanding the Chemical Profile
2,4-Dichlorofluorobenzene, chemically known as C6H3Cl2F, is characterized by its structure: a benzene ring substituted with two chlorine atoms and one fluorine atom. It typically presents as a clear, colorless to pale yellow liquid. Its utility in synthesis stems from the reactivity imparted by these halogen substituents, making it an ideal building block for complex organic molecules. Researchers and manufacturers rely on its specific chemical properties to achieve targeted synthesis outcomes.
A Key Intermediate for Fluoroquinolone Antibiotics
The most significant application of 2,4-Dichlorofluorobenzene in the pharmaceutical sector is its use as a key intermediate in the synthesis of fluoroquinolone antibiotics. These broad-spectrum antibiotics are vital in treating a wide range of bacterial infections. The precise incorporation of the fluorinated benzene ring structure from 2,4-Dichlorofluorobenzene is crucial for the efficacy and pharmacological profile of these life-saving drugs. For pharmaceutical companies, ensuring a stable and high-quality supply of this intermediate is directly linked to their production capacity and the availability of essential medicines.
Other Pharmaceutical Applications and Agrochemical Use
Beyond fluoroquinolones, 2,4-Dichlorofluorobenzene also serves as an intermediate in the synthesis of other pharmaceutical compounds, including certain antipsychotic drugs. Its versatility extends to the agrochemical industry, where it is utilized in the production of pesticides and insecticides. This dual application highlights its importance across different chemical sectors.
